Your blackline still looks great though matt.

Iv now done around 100mile on these wheels, there is a very small difference in ride. Im presuming simply due to the lower profile tyre. But the car rides so well over bumps, firm but smooth at the same time, my mk2 would crash and all plastics rattle over bumps (maybe a little extreme) but the mk3 glides over them, you obviously notice bumps but not in the same way, hard to describe really.

Im very pleased with the Xtreme wheels and to anyone who likes them think they are well worth the money :).

There is a PR Code on etka for 19" wheels.

C6Q Aluminium Disc 7.5x19 ET51.

I don't know if that is the same wheel as Robfabs.
